The effects of a high BUN on blastocoele fluid urea concentrations and analyzed the transcriptome of day-14 equine embryos based upon RNA sequencing. Overall design: When a 25 ± 3 mm follicle was detected, mares were randomly allocated to a urea (n=9) or control treatment (n=10). The urea treatment consisted of an oral supplementation of urea (0.4 g/kg of body weight), mixed with sweet feed and molasses. The control treatment was sweet feed and molasses alone. Blood samples were collected every other day for BUN analysis, one hour after feeding. Mares were artificially inseminated in the presence of a 35-mm follicle and ovulation was detected (D0). Ultrasonographic exams for pregnancy detection started at D11, and embryo collection was done at D14 (n=5 urea-treated embryos; n=7 control embryos). RNA was extracted from embryos for RNA sequencing.
